Understanding the Canadian Online Gambling Landscape

Canada’s approach to online gambling is a patchwork of provincial regulations and federal laws. Some provinces, like Ontario, have embraced a regulated market, while others operate under different frameworks. This means the availability of specific games, the licensing of operators, and the level of consumer protection can vary significantly depending on where you reside. Understanding the legalities in your province is paramount. Always ensure that the online casino you choose is properly licensed and regulated by a reputable authority, such as the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) or a similar provincial body.

Key Regulatory Considerations

Here are some key aspects to consider:

  • Licensing: Verify the operator’s license. Look for licenses from recognized jurisdictions.
  • Payment Methods: Ensure the casino supports secure and reliable payment options that are convenient for you.
  • Responsible Gambling Tools: Look for features like de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ations.
  • Game Fairness: Reputable casinos use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ure fair play. Look for independent audits and certifications.

Provincial Variations

The online gambling landscape varies across provinces. For instance, Ontario has a regulated market, offering a wider range of licensed operators. Other provinces might have government-run online casinos or allow access to offshore platforms. Research the specific regulations in your province to understand what is permitted and what is not.

Bonuses and Promotions: A Calculated Advantage

Bonuses and promotions can significantly boost your bankroll, but it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ions. Wel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ty programs are common. However, pay close attention to wagering requirements, game contributions, and expiry dates. A bonus with high wagering requirements might not be as valuable as it seems. Read the fine print and assess whether the bonus aligns with your playing style and strategy.

Bankroll Management: The Cornerstone of Success

Effective bankroll management is crucial for long-term profitability. Decide on a budget and stick to it. Set loss limits and win goals. Never chase losses. Adjust your bet sizes based on your bankroll and the game’s volatility. Consider using a staking plan, such as the Martingale system (though be aware of its risks) or the Fibonacci sequence. The key is to protect your bankroll and avoid impulsive decisions.
